Law of supply states that other factors remaining constant, price and quantity supplied of a good are directly related to each other. In other words, when the price paid by buyers for a good rises, then suppliers increase the supply of that good in the market.

I feel that Paul Feyerabend’s belief falls more into a postmodernism method of thinking because postmodernism is all about challenging the structured way of thinking that is commonly used by modernism.
Postmodern thinkers frequently call attention to the contingent or socially-conditioned nature of knowledge claims and value systems, situating them as products of particular political, historical, or cultural discourses and hierarchies.
